Given the following function, find h(-4)
h(x) = 8x2 – 5
h(-4) =

Answer:

h(-4) = 123

Step-by-step explanation:

h(x) = 8x² – 5

h(-4) = 8(-4)² - 5

h(-4) = 8(16) - 5

h(-4) = 128 - 5

h(-4) = 123
